Scouting Report & Player Insights
Ísak Bergmann Jóhannesson is a young Icelandic central midfielder known for his energetic, box-to-box style, combining pressing intensity with tidy passing to link defense and attack. He has established himself as a regular in Iceland's national team setup while developing his club career in the Bundesliga with 1. FC Köln. His game is built more on work rate and reliability than standout technical flair, profiling as a developing rotation-to-starter option in a top-five league.
